org.hibernate.envers.internal.entities.mapper.relation.MapCollectionMapper Maven / Gradle / Ivy
/*
* Hibernate, Relational Persistence for Idiomatic Java
*
* License: GNU Lesser General Public License (LGPL), version 2.1 or later.
* See the lgpl.txt file in the root directory or .
*/
package org.hibernate.envers.internal.entities.mapper.relation;
import java.io.Serializable;
import java.util.ArrayList;
import java.util.Collection;
import java.util.HashSet;
import java.util.Iterator;
import java.util.List;
import java.util.Map;
import java.util.Set;
import org.hibernate.collection.spi.PersistentCollection;
import org.hibernate.engine.spi.SessionImplementor;
import org.hibernate.envers.RevisionType;
import org.hibernate.envers.boot.internal.EnversService;
import org.hibernate.envers.internal.entities.mapper.PersistentCollectionChangeData;
import org.hibernate.envers.internal.entities.mapper.PropertyMapper;
import org.hibernate.envers.internal.entities.mapper.relation.lazy.initializor.Initializor;
import org.hibernate.envers.internal.entities.mapper.relation.lazy.initializor.MapCollectionInitializor;
import org.hibernate.envers.internal.reader.AuditReaderImplementor;
import org.hibernate.persister.collection.CollectionPersister;
/**
* @author Adam Warski (adam at warski dot org)
* @author Chris Cranford
*/
public class MapCollectionMapper extends AbstractCollectionMapper implements PropertyMapper {
protected final MiddleComponentData elementComponentData;
protected final MiddleComponentData indexComponentData;
public MapCollectionMapper(
CommonCollectionMapperData commonCollectionMapperData,
Class collectionClass, Class proxyClass,
MiddleComponentData elementComponentData, MiddleComponentData indexComponentData,
boolean revisionTypeInId) {
super( commonCollectionMapperData, collectionClass, proxyClass, false, revisionTypeInId );
this.elementComponentData = elementComponentData;
this.indexComponentData = indexComponentData;
}
@Override
protected Initializor getInitializor(
EnversService enversService,
AuditReaderImplementor versionsReader,
Object primaryKey,
Number revision,
boolean removed) {
return new MapCollectionInitializor<>(
enversService,
versionsReader,
commonCollectionMapperData.getQueryGenerator(),
primaryKey,
revision,
removed,
collectionClass,
elementComponentData,
indexComponentData
);
}
@Override
protected Collection getNewCollectionContent(PersistentCollection newCollection) {
if ( newCollection == null ) {
return null;
}
else {
return ( (Map) newCollection ).entrySet();
}
}
@Override
protected Collection getOldCollectionContent(Serializable oldCollection) {
if ( oldCollection == null ) {
return null;
}
else {
return ( (Map) oldCollection ).entrySet();
}
}
@Override
protected void mapToMapFromObject(
SessionImplementor session,
Map idData,
Map data,
Object changed) {
elementComponentData.getComponentMapper().mapToMapFromObject(
session,
idData,
data,
( (Map.Entry) changed ).getValue()
);
indexComponentData.getComponentMapper().mapToMapFromObject(
session,
idData,
data,
( (Map.Entry) changed ).getKey()
);
}
@Override
protected Set buildCollectionChangeSet(Object eventCollection, Collection collection) {
final Set changeSet = new HashSet<>();
if ( eventCollection != null ) {
for ( Object entry : collection ) {
if ( entry != null ) {
final Map.Entry element = Map.Entry.class.cast( entry );
if ( element.getValue() == null ) {
continue;
}
changeSet.add( entry );
}
}
}
return changeSet;
}
@Override
protected boolean isSame(CollectionPersister collectionPersister, Object oldObject, Object newObject) {
final Map.Entry oldEntry = Map.Entry.class.cast( oldObject );
final Map.Entry newEntry = Map.Entry.class.cast( newObject );
if ( collectionPersister.getKeyType().isSame( oldEntry.getKey(), newEntry.getKey() ) ) {
if ( collectionPersister.getElementType().isSame( oldEntry.getValue(), newEntry.getValue() ) ) {
return true;
}
}
return false;
}
@Override
public List mapCollectionChanges(
SessionImplementor session,
PersistentCollection newColl,
Serializable oldColl,
Serializable id) {
final List collectionChanges = new ArrayList<>();
final CollectionPersister collectionPersister = resolveCollectionPersister( session, newColl );
// Comparing new and old collection content
final Collection newCollection = getNewCollectionContent( newColl );
final Collection oldCollection = getOldCollectionContent( oldColl );
// take the new collection and remove any that exist in the old collection.
// take the resulting Set<> and generate ADD changes
final Set added = buildCollectionChangeSet( newColl, newCollection );
if ( oldColl != null ) {
for ( Object oldObject : oldCollection ) {
for ( Iterator itor = added.iterator(); itor.hasNext(); ) {
Object newObject = itor.next();
if ( isSame( collectionPersister, oldObject, newObject ) ) {
itor.remove();
break;
}
}
}
}
// take the old collection and remove any that exist in the new collection.
// take the resulting Set<> and generate DEL changes.
final Set deleted = buildCollectionChangeSet( oldColl, oldCollection );
if ( newColl != null ) {
for ( Object newObject : newCollection ) {
for ( Iterator itor = deleted.iterator(); itor.hasNext(); ) {
Object oldObject = itor.next();
if ( isSame( collectionPersister, newObject, oldObject ) ) {
itor.remove();
break;
}
}
}
}
addCollectionChanges( session, collectionChanges, added, RevisionType.ADD, id );
addCollectionChanges( session, collectionChanges, deleted, RevisionType.DEL, id );
return collectionChanges;
}
}
